Match Report:

By Simon Fudge/whitecapsfc.com

Vancouver Whitecaps FC Residency began their two-game USL Premier Development League road trip to Washington State with an important 4-1 win over Yakima Reds on Friday evening.

First-half goals by Gagandeep Dosanjh and Alex Semenets canceled out Andrew O'Brien's early strike for Yakima in what was a pivotal PDL Western Conference Northwest Division encounter at Marquette Stadium. Second half goals by Philippe Davies and Randy Edwini-Bonsu ensured that Thomas Niendorf's side moved three points clear at the top of the division standings.

After falling 1-0 at home to the Reds on June 29, the young Whitecaps were keen to make up for that defeat at Simon Fraser University by boosting their PDL playoff chances in the reverse fixture on Friday. Included in the Whitecaps starting line-up were first-team members Mason Trafford in the backline and forward Nick Webb, who partnered Edwini-Bonsu in attack.

Things did not start so well for the Residency squad, as Yakima took the lead when O'Brien converted Luis Galvan's pass after just six minutes of play.

Undeterred, the Whitecaps took just five minutes to restore parity with a fine header from Dosanjh after Semenets found the midfielder with a cross to the near post.

On 39 minutes, Semenets himself found the scoresheet with an unstoppable 25-yard strike that flew into the top corner of the Reds goal to give Vancouver a 2-1 lead at halftime.

After making changes and re-organizing for the start of the second half, Whitecaps Residency extended their lead on 51 minutes. Semenets recorded his second assist by playing a through ball into the path of Davies, who then side-footed his finish into the top corner of Yakima's goal for 3-1.

Any hopes of a Reds comeback ended on 63 minutes, as another fine through ball by Ethan Gage allowed Edwini-Bonsu to finish with aplomb for a convincing three-goal victory.

90 FULL MINUTES

Where the first half proved more of an even contest, the Residency team's fitness eventually wore their hosts down, with the result dealing a blow to Yakima's hopes of claiming a playoff place.

Whitecaps Residency will look to further cement their spot in the PDL postseason when they visit the struggling Spokane Spiders on Saturday evening. Yakima, meanwhile, must turn things around in their final home game of the season, as another British Columbia club in Abbotsford Mariners visit Marquette Stadium on Saturday.
